[eng][cze] Laser welding method is widely used in the industrial production, from micro welding of electronic parts to joining automobile and aeroplane parts. Distribution of temperature field in narrow heat affected zone and following mechanical deformation and residual stresses of part can be modelled by FDM numerical software SYSWELD.Pomocí programu SYSWELD byly modelovány teplotní pole, deformace a zbytková napětí ve svařovaných součástech.
